Doris's Piano

Doris Piano
<http://www.voxnovus.com/NM421/issue/postcard/13-04-27-Doris_Piano.jpg>

Oh no, not again! groaned Doris. It seemed like every time she played Manual
de Falla's "Ritual Fire Dance" these days, the darned piano burst into
flames! Trying to ignore the fire, she bowed to the audience, but her left
hand brushed against the piano. Yeow!, it was hot, she thought, as she
recoiled and accidentally knocked over the piano bench. An annoying whine
from the theater's smoke detector interrupted the applause, prompting
several spectators to look around in apprehension. Doris worried that they
might leave before she got to the last piece on her recital, and a weird
clause in her performance contract stipulated that "payment for services
rendered is contingent on audience members staying to the very last note."
She righted the bench, sat down, cracked her knuckles, and began her final
piece, Jerome Kern's "Smoke Gets in Your Eyes." But the keys were hot and
getting hotter, and she found she had to play it a lot more staccato than
normal, which seriously compromised the tune's usually soothing quality. Out
of the corner of her eye, she spotted several people in the theater stand up
and put on their coats. She upped the tempo, turning the ballad into a
quickstep. With corresponding speed, the fire jumped from the piano to the
stage and from the stage to the orchestra. Two women shrieked in parallel
fifths, their palpable fear seeming to fan the flames. The fire moved
quickly, engulfing the rest of the downstairs and heading for the balcony.
By now, the black keys were smoking and too hot to touch - a real problem
for a piece rooted in B major. So Doris modulated up a half-step, then
stepped on the piano's middle pedal: the accelerator. The resulting
prestissimo got the piece to the final chord just before the ceiling
collapsed - and, presumably, before anyone made it out of the theater. Her
part of the contract satisfied, Doris staggered off-stage, with smoke not
only in her eyes but also in her nose and throat. Next time, she vowed,
she'd stick to Handel's "Water Music."

<http://www.davidgunn.org> David Gunn

Guest Curator: Cellist Suzanne Mueller made her New York recital debut under
the auspices of Artists International, as a member of the piano/cello
Elysian Duo, and went on to perform as half of its successor, Elysian II,
for ten years, before forming CROSS ISLAND with Ms. Zayas. She also
performed for a decade as half of McCarron & Mueller, with
guitarist/composer/arranger Mark McCarron. Currently, she is Beech Tree
Concerts Artist-in-Residence at Old Westbury Gardens, where she presents a
series of outdoor summer concerts with various partners She is also a
frequent performer on the Composer's Voice concert series.

60x60 Video EMM (Electronic Music Midwest) Mix, a collection of one-minute
Videos created by students from Digital Studio, Washington University, St.
Louis will have a premiere screening on May 1, Wednesday, 7:00 pm, at Brown
100 Theater, Brown Hall Washington University, St. Louis

60x60 is a project containing 60 compositions each 60 seconds in length
presented continuously in an hour performance with 60 experimental videos
for each composition. www.60x60.com The EMM mix is comprised from music by
composers and artists who have participated in both the Electronic Music
Midwest festival and the 60x60 project.

The 60x60 Presenters mix is designed to honor and present those composers
who have helped promote the 60x60 cause. This mix of 60x60 includes the
works of composers who have presented 60x60 performances in the past,
present and future. Robert Ratcliffe is the audio coordinator for the 60x60
(2012) Presenters Mix.

Rodrigo Baggio <http://www.voxnovus.com/member/pic/Rodrigo_Baggio_01.jpg>

Rodrigo Baggio has excelled internationally in 2012, playing concerts and
having his music played in various countries around the globe. He was the
guest guitarist of Universite Laval (Quebec) in their 2012 winter semester,
premiering four compositions ("Serra Verde" - for guitar, "Suite Americas" -
for guitar and trombone, "Lampada do Operario" - for tenor, guitar and
trombone and "Ciclo de Improvisacoes Sobre Memorias Regionais" - for guitar
and tenor saxophone) commissioned by the great trombone player Dr. James C.
Lebens for that special occasion. Alongside the concerts, Mr. Baggio has
composed music for different ensembles and projects such as "Fantasia
Brasileira I" (for guitar) specially written for Prof. Brian Katz
(University Of Toronto). His piece "Three Insights Of The Brazilian
Landscape" (for Percussion) was one of the winner pieces of "Carl von
Ossietzky Composition Prize" at Oldenburg University (Germany). A former
pupil of Jaime Barbosa (Composition/University of Ribeirao Preto), Dr.
Marcos Cavalcante (Improvisation/University of Campinas) and Arrigo Barnabe
(Composition/ULM), Baggio is currently developing his own project called
"Guitar Solo" in which Composition and Improvisation are combined on a
particular way of instrumental performance.

Lis de Carvalho <http://www.voxnovus.com/member/pic/Lis_de_Carvalho_01.jpg>


Pianist, arranger and composer Lis de Carvalho started her Music education
with her mother, Dinea de Carvalho Ferrete when she was 6 years old and
later studied with piano jazz with Hilton Jorge Valente (Gogo); composition
with Prof. H. J. Koellroeuter; harmony, arrangement and Orquestration with
Prof. Claudio Leal Ferreira; Electronic Music and Synthesizer Programming at
Escola Sintesis; Advanced Piano with Prof. Maria Jose Carrasqueira. Lis
obtained a Bachelor's Degree in Philosophy -at FFCHL ( Faculdade de
Filosofia, Ciencias Humanas e Letras) and a Bachelor's Degree in Jazz Piano
at FASM (Faculdade Santa Marcelina). Lis de Carvalho teaches piano and
harmony, as well as the coordinator of the Jazz Piano Program at Tom Jobim
EMESP - ( Estado de Sao Paulo Music School). She has performed with the
following musicians: Paulo Moura, Raul de Souza, Lula Galvao, Roberto Sion,
Altamiro Carrilho, Edu Lobo e Orquestra Jazz Sinfonica, Quarteto em Cy,
Vania Bastos, Tete Spindola, Eliete Negreiros, Zeze Mota, Paula Lima,
Margareth Menezes, Walter Franco, among others. Lis de Carvalho has recorded
a Bossa Nova piano solo CD, for the MPBaby Series, MCD record. She has
launched a digital video class by HMP Publishing Company and recorded many
of her compositions in several CDs and DVDs with Celso Pixinga and other
mainstream musicians of vocal and instrumental music. Lis has recently
(2012) released her own CD Caminho de Dentro at the live TV Program Ses.
